To fix the ESPN app on your iPhone, start by checking your internet connection. If the issue persists, try restarting the app or the iPhone. Updating the app via the App Store can also resolve problems as newer versions often contain bug fixes. If all else fails, delete and reinstall the app. This method can eliminate corrupted files causing the malfunction. Remember to sign back in with your credentials after reinstallation to restore your settings and preferences.
FAQs & Answers
- Why is my ESPN app not working on my iPhone? Common issues include poor internet connection, outdated app versions, or corrupted app data. Restarting the app or updating it via the App Store often resolves these problems.
- How do I update the ESPN app on my iPhone? Open the App Store, tap your profile icon, scroll to find ESPN, and tap 'Update' if an update is available.
- Will reinstalling the ESPN app delete my account or settings? Reinstalling may remove local settings, but once you sign back in with your credentials, your account information and preferences will be restored.
- How can I improve ESPN app performance on my iPhone? Ensure a stable internet connection, keep the app updated, and periodically restart your iPhone to maintain optimal app performance.
